#3949ad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3949ad is composed of 22.4% red, 28.6%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 57.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 231.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 45.1%. #3949ad color hex could be obtained by blending #7292ff with #00005b.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#3949ad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3949ad has RGB values of R:57, G:73,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 3754413.

Hex triplet 3949ad #3949ad
RGB Decimal 57, 73, 173 rgb(57,73,173)
RGB Percent 22.4, 28.6, 67.8 rgb(22.4%,28.6%,67.8%)
CMYK 67, 58, 0, 32
HSL 231.7°, 50.4, 45.1 hsl(231.7,50.4%,45.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 231.7°, 67.1, 67.8
Web Safe 333399 #333399
CIE-LAB 35.304, 26.954, -55.486
XYZ 11.611, 8.651, 40.591
xyY 0.191, 0.142, 8.651
CIE-LCH 35.304, 61.686, 295.91
CIE-LUV 35.304, -9.798, -79.149
Hunter-Lab 29.413, 18.991, -61.232
Binary 00111001, 01001001, 10101101
